Had the fortune of spending the day with Marty Schottenheimer

Some of you have seen the film for Marty that I was a part of that featured 17 of Marty's former players from KC, Cleveland, SD sharing memories and offering well-wishes. Last week, my friend and co-producer went out to NC to meet the Schottenheimer's and show the the film in person. It was unreal watching Marty react to these wonderful moments that he was a part of. Even though the Alzheimer's has taken away some of his memory, he can still recall a lot of his football-related life and that made us happy. His wife Pat is a saint and the day could not have gone any better. Here's a video of Marty reacting to watching our film:

Broncos fan here, through and through, but Marty is one of the coaches for whom I have a tremendous amount of respect. He was tough, fair, and ALWAYS had well prepared teams that were competitive regardless of roster strength. I hated seeing him across the field. He never won a title but he is definitely one of the great coaches in the game. Wins and losses are one thing but Marty always placed the character of his players and his team as a priority because, ultimately, that's what matters more. Sports brings character out of people in immediate ways and he understood that and used it as a tool to develop better people as well as better players. I hope for nothing but the best for him and his family.
